UHC Service Coverage sub-index on noncommunicable diseases - SDG 3.8.1 in Cuba
Cuba: UHC Service Coverage sub-index on noncommunicable diseases - SDG 3.8.1 was 69 in 2023. ▲ Rising
UHC Service Coverage sub-index on noncommunicable diseases - SDG 3.8.1 in Cuba, 2000–2023
Source: UNICEF.
Analysis
The most recent figure for uhc service coverage sub-index on noncommunicable diseases - sdg 3.8.1 in Cuba is 69, measured in 2023. That is the highest value across all 24 years on record.
The figure is up 11.3% over ten years.
Over the whole period, uhc service coverage sub-index on noncommunicable diseases - sdg 3.8.1 in Cuba peaked at 69 in 2022 and was at its lowest, 43, in 2000.
Cuba ranks 17th of 32 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 24 years of available data.
